Use Any Font

Description

Use any custom fonts you wish and give your site a elegant look. No css knowledge required.

Click here for Use Any Font working demo.

Use Any Font gives you freedom to use custom fonts in your website. It is not like other font embed services which gives you countable number of fonts to select from neither the one that stores your font in remote server. You can use any custom font if you have its font format (ttf,otf,woff) without being dependent to other’s server uptime.

Features

  • Quick and easy to setup. No css or any rocket science knowledge needed.
  • Support all major browsers including IE 6+, Firefox, Chrome, Safari, IOS, Andriod, Opera and more.
  • Font conversion within the plugin interface font uploader and quick font assign interface. You can select pre defined html tags or assign it to custom css.
  • Use uploaded font directly from WordPress Editor,
    Divi Builder,
    Site Origin Page Buider,
    Elementor Page Builder,
    Beaver Builder,
    Themify Builder, and any visual builder using the class.
  • Custom fonts uploaded can be directly used from Theme options panel for major themeforest themes like Avada, X Theme, Salient, Oshine, KLEO, ShopKeeper, SimpleMag, Porto and many more (540+). Check out full list here.
  • Supports font format including ttf, otf, woff. The required fonts are converted automatically.
  • Accepts custom font file upto 15 MB.
  • Embed fonts using @font-face css. SEO friendly and quick loading.
  • Multiple custom fonts can be used.
  • Faster load time as your custom fonts are stored on your own server.

Support

You need API key to connect to our server for font conversion. Our server converts your font and sends it back.

Offer your contribution (Free for 1 font, $20 to $100) and get the API key from here.

Installation Video

Note : We don’t store your fonts in our server neither any of your information except the API key details. Our server deletes the temporary file after the conversion is done.

We don’t respond to support tickets created here. Please visit our support forum for your issues.

Screenshots

  • Screenshot #1. Use Any Font Demo
  • Screenshot #2. Use Any Font Plugin Setup
  • Screenshot #3. Assign font directly from WordPress Editor
  • Screenshot #4. Font list not showing in editor.
  • Screenshot #5. Disable font list in editor.
  • Screenshot #6. Assign fonts to custom elements.

Installation

  1. Upload the plugin use-any-font files to the /wp-content/plugins/ directory
  2. Activate the use-any-font plugin through the ‘Plugins’ menu in WordPress.
  3. Get the API key and verify it (Needed to connect to server for font conversion).
  4. Select Use Any Font under Settings
  5. Upload your custom font.
  6. Assign your font to element.
  7. You can also assign the custom font directly from wordpress page/post editor.
  8. Your fonts are working in your site now.
  9. You may refer to Screenshots tab for visual instructions.

FAQ

Installation Instructions
  1. Upload the plugin use-any-font files to the /wp-content/plugins/ directory
  2. Activate the use-any-font plugin through the ‘Plugins’ menu in WordPress.
  3. Get the API key and verify it (Needed to connect to server for font conversion).
  4. Select Use Any Font under Settings
  5. Upload your custom font.
  6. Assign your font to element.
  7. You can also assign the custom font directly from wordpress page/post editor.
  8. Your fonts are working in your site now.
  9. You may refer to Screenshots tab for visual instructions.
Which font format does plugin accepts and the font size ?

Currently, ttf, otf, woff font format are accepted. Font file upto 15MB is acceptable. However, we suggest you to use smaller ones as far as possible. The font file size directly affects your site load time.

Does it works with multiple fonts ?

Ya, it works with multiple fonts. For multiple font conversion request, you need to get the Premium Key.

Do i need to manually convert fonts ?

No, you don’t need to do it yourself. Just upload your font(supports most of the font format), and the plugin does the rest.

Does it work with Visual Builder like Divi Builder ?

Ya, it works with any visual builder. For that you can assign class to those elements. Class name are same as font name. Also, we have full support for Divi Builder and SiteOrigin Page Builder. You can assign fonts using their font family dropdown.

You can check video for more details.
Divi Builder : https://www.youtube.com/watch?v=Y24TtwNHFMY
Site Origin Page Buider : https://www.youtube.com/watch?v=dA-iXWZSCYs

Does it works with any theme ?

Its built in Font Upload and Font assign section allows you to assign custom fonts to any theme. However, for popular themes like Avada, X Theme, Salient, Oshine, KLEO, ShopKeeper, SimpleMag, Porto and many more (540+). Check out full list here., we have added extra features that allows you to assign the custom font to your theme using the theme options panel.

Where are my fonts stored ?

All the fonts are stored in your own server. Our server only convert the fonts and sends back.

Does my font depends upon plugin’s server uptime ?

No, our server is needed during font conversion only. After that all fonts are served from your own server.

Not working for me. What can i do ?

Virtual Support to solve common issues. It covers almost 80% of repeated issues.
Support Forum to quickly resolve your issues.
Rectify My Problem for personal assitance.

Reviews

Awesome plugin – forget Google Fonts

i was looking for a solution to replace Google Fonts with all the privacy problems. I like to pay for a good solution, because i want to keep it running. And it helps to keep the developer running. Wonder that some people here don’t understand that.

Had some struggles in the beginning, but it is the same with every solution – it is called “learning curve”. That also means to learn about the typical problem zones. One of those is the web conversion of the font, which can fail sometimes! If you know this, you try it again, until it works.

Maybe it could be more comfortable, if the conversion would be tested by the tool in admin area. Hopefully this will be the next feature – if we keep the developer running. There is no other tool like that, as I know!

Es de pago

Solo deja convertir una fuente, ahora lo estoy realizando de la manera tradicional

Rediculous

You can only upload 1 custom font before you have to pay. Not sure how they racked up this many positive reviews for a “free” plugin that might as well be paid.

Amazing plugin with great support

This plugin is amazing! It solved all our issues with “loading Google fonts” and improved our website loading speed.
Also support is great, professional and efficient!

Exactly What I Was Looking For

Great plugin! I wish I would have found it earlier rather than wasting so much time fiddling with importing fonts. It does everything I was looking for in an easy to use way.

I also emailed the devs about implementing the plugin with Beaver Builder. I was responded to RIGHT AWAY, with a link to a beta version of the plugin. The devs clearly care about their customers. I am more than happy with my experience.

Read all 796 reviews

Contributors & Developers

“Use Any Font” is open source software. The following people have contributed to this plugin.

Contributors

Translate “Use Any Font” into your language.

Interested in development?

Browse the code, check out the SVN repository, or subscribe to the development log by RSS.

Changelog

4.9.2

  • Adds custom fonts to typography of Themify and Beaver Page Builder

4.9.1

  • Adds custom fonts to typography of Elemenator Page Builder

4.7.3

  • Adds custom fonts to theme options panel for themes like Avada, Salient, Oshine, X Theme, KLEO. (540+ Themes in total)

4.7.2

  • SiteOrigin Page Builder Support

4.7.1

  • Divi Theme Issue Fixes.

4.7

  • Full Support For Divi Admin Visual Builder
  • Use of relative path as default nowonwards
  • Alternative server selection for font upload and API verification.

4.6

  • Directly assign font to element using the class identical to font name.

4.5.1

  • Fixed form validation js error.

4.5

  • Fixed SSL font loading issue.

4.4.4

  • Font upload issue fixed.

4.4.3

  • Fixed couldn’t receive font file issue.

4.4.2

  • Fixed API verification issue

4.4.1

  • Fixed SSL API key issue

4.3.7

  • Secure file upload URL for Default Js Uploader

4.3.6

  • Fixed validation for PHP uploader
  • Sanitize font name
  • Test with 4.3.1

4.3.5

  • Fixed host name lookup issue
  • Added SSL for font upload path
  • Test with 4.3

4.3.4

  • License key trim added.

4.3.3

  • Font convertor url change.

4.3.2

  • Added relative font path settings.
  • Added Css version system.

4.3.1

  • Add js extension validation for font file.

4.3

  • Ajax Font Upload
  • Fixed Couldn’t receive font file for conversion issue.

4.2.4

  • Font size increase to 10 MB
  • Fixed js validation issue.
  • Add server side validation for font file.

4.2.3

  • Removed rarely used font formats from being upload. They were making font onvertor server down repeatedly.
  • Fixed name validation issue

4.2.2

  • Tested to work with wordpress 4.0
  • Jquery Validation Plugin Updated

4.2.1

  • Using wp_remote_get inplace of wp_remove_fopen for API Key

4.2

  • Compatible with 3.9
  • Fixed font list issue in editor for 3.9

4.1.1

  • Minor update
  • Added font formats (dfont, suit)
  • Updated FAQ and Screenshots.
  • Tested with 3.8.1

4.1

  • Added Support for SSL (https)
  • Additional settings to disbale font list in wordpress editor.
  • Tested with 3.8

4.0

  • Added Network Site Support
  • Assign font directly from WordPress Editor

3.2

  • Tested with 3.5.2

3.1

  • Minor update
  • Add woff and svg font format

3.0

  • Major update
  • Supports more font format now.
  • Better error handling
  • Added hyperlink (a tag) in default element select.

2.1

  • Added file upload validation.

2.0

  • Added server connectivity test.

1.1

  • Fixed font not loading issue when there is space in font file name.
  • Added Instructions in Plugin Interface.

1.0

  • First Release